Brazil Poultry Diagnostics Market Overview

Market Size & Growth :

Brazil's poultry diagnostics market is valued at USD 5.33 million in 2026 and is projected to reach USD 7.26 million by 2031, with a steady CAGR of 6.4%, outpacing many regional markets in Latin America.

Leading Producer Advantage :

As Latin America's largest poultry producer, Brazil's dominance in chicken and egg production creates substantial demand for diagnostic solutions to maintain flock health, biosecurity, and export compliance standards.

Investment in Modernization :

Brazilian poultry producers are increasingly investing in advanced diagnostic technologies to enhance productivity, reduce disease outbreaks, and meet stringent international food safety and animal welfare regulations.

Export-Driven Quality Standards :

Brazil's significant poultry exports to global markets necessitate robust diagnostic capabilities to prevent disease transmission, ensure product quality, and maintain competitive advantage in international trade.

    Market Definition

    The poultry diagnostics market comprises products and services used for the detection, identification, and monitoring of infectious diseases in poultry species, including broilers, layers, and breeders. It includes diagnostic kits, reagents, consumables, instruments, and laboratory services based on technologies such as PCR, ELISA, rapid immunoassays, and other molecular and serological methods. These solutions are utilized by veterinary diagnostic laboratories, commercial poultry producers, research institutions, and government agencies for routine surveillance, outbreak confirmation, biosecurity compliance, and export certification. The market supports early disease detection, flock health management, and control of transboundary and endemic poultry diseases.
